Long-Term Return Does Not Reflect Tonight’s Period
Numerous users misinterpret RTP as a guarantee for their own session. Observing 97% does not indicate losing only $3 per $100 tonight. Short-term returns deviate dramatically from theoretical averages. An Vegashero might deliver 120% or 60% during a several hundred plays. Statistical convergence toward published RTP requires sample sizes beyond what majority users collect, making the rate a inadequate forecast of individual outcomes.

House edge indicates the mathematical advantage operators possess over participants. Computed as 100% less RTP, a game with 96% return has a 4% house margin. This proportion describes the casino’s projected profit from all bets over time. The margin relates to aggregate money wagered, not just original contributions.

Return to Player denotes the expected proportion returned over millions of spins. A 96% RTP signifies the game pays $96 for every $100 wagered across its full duration. This figure covers huge sample sizes that single gamblers never achieve during normal periods. The percentage depicts combined returns rather than individual results.
